Kayak at Core Creek Park
Kayak on Lake Luxembourg at Core Creek Park! It's a beautiful and quiet lake with serene views of the forest and park. You can rent boats and water bikes at the park, or bring your own, and launch directly onto the lake. To access the Lake, use the entrance to Core Creek Park on Bridgetown Pike. ...Read more -
